Rowland ANDERSON Obituary

ANDERSON,
Rowland Davie (Roly):
Peacefully at home surrounded by family, on Sunday, June 4, 2023, after a short illness; in his 93rd year. Dearly loved husband and soulmate of the late Jean. Much loved father and father-in-law of Sue and Gerard Coll, Margy and Paul Wanty, Lyn and Brendan Cox, and Robyn Anderson. Beloved grandad of his 11 grandchildren and 7 great-grandchildren. Loved brother and brother-in-law of Jim, Ailsa Marychurch (dec), Melba Lord, Jean and Fraser Aitken, and a much loved uncle. A service to celebrate Roly's life will be held at Aoraki Funeral Services Chapel, 160 Mountain View Road, Timaru, on Saturday, June 10, 2023 at 1.30pm, followed by a private cremation.
